Born: August 22, 1823, Hampstead, Middlesex, England.

Died: February 8, 1901.

Powell was educated at Oriel College, Oxford (B.A. 1845). Ordained in 1846, he was curate of Cookham-Dean, near Maidenhead; and then vicar of Bisham, 1848. His works include:

  • The Holy Feast
  • Hymns, Anthems, &c., for Public Worship
